The Rising Popularity Of High Strength Plastics: A Game Changer In The Manufacturing Industry

In recent years, there has been a significant shift towards the use of high strength plastics in various industries. These materials, also known as engineering plastics or high performance plastics, offer a wide range of advantages over traditional materials like metal or glass. From improved durability to enhanced design flexibility, high strength plastics are proving to be a game changer in the manufacturing industry.

One of the key benefits of high strength plastics is their exceptional mechanical properties. These materials are known for their high tensile strength, impact resistance, and toughness. This makes them ideal for applications where traditional materials would fail under stress or pressure. For example, high strength plastics are commonly used in the automotive industry for making lightweight yet durable parts like bumpers, body panels, and interior components.

Another advantage of high strength plastics is their chemical resistance. These materials are highly resistant to a wide range of chemicals, solvents, and oils, making them ideal for use in corrosive environments. This property makes high strength plastics a popular choice for applications in the chemical processing, pharmaceutical, and food and beverage industries. They can withstand exposure to harsh chemicals without degradation, ensuring long-lasting performance and reliability.

In addition to their mechanical and chemical properties, high strength plastics offer excellent thermal stability. These materials can withstand a wide range of temperatures without losing their properties, making them suitable for use in extreme hot or cold environments. This thermal resistance makes high strength plastics ideal for applications in the aerospace, electronics, and medical industries, where temperature fluctuations are common.

Moreover, high strength plastics are highly versatile in terms of design flexibility. These materials can be easily molded into complex shapes and geometries, allowing for intricate designs that are not possible with traditional materials. This design flexibility opens up a world of possibilities for manufacturers, enabling them to create innovative products that meet the specific needs of their customers. From intricate medical devices to lightweight aircraft components, high strength plastics are revolutionizing the way products are designed and manufactured.

The lightweight nature of high strength plastics is another major advantage that sets them apart from traditional materials. These materials are significantly lighter than metals like steel or aluminum, making them ideal for applications where weight reduction is critical. The use of high strength plastics in industries like automotive, aerospace, and transportation is helping to reduce fuel consumption, lower emissions, and improve overall efficiency.

One of the most appealing features of high strength plastics is their cost-effectiveness. While these materials may have a higher upfront cost than traditional materials, they offer long-term savings in terms of durability, maintenance, and replacement costs. High strength plastics are known for their long service life and resistance to wear and tear, reducing the need for frequent repairs or replacements. This cost-effectiveness makes high strength plastics a wise investment for companies looking to improve their bottom line.

The growing demand for high strength plastics has led to advancements in manufacturing processes and technologies. Today, manufacturers have access to a wide range of high strength plastics that offer different properties and performance characteristics. From glass-reinforced thermoplastics to carbon fiber composites, there are numerous options available to meet the specific requirements of different industries and applications.
